Russian President Vladimir Putin had a telephone conversation with his Turkish counterpart Recep Tayyip Erdogan, Report informs citing RIA Novosti report quoting the Kremlin press service.
Vladimir Putin briefed his Turkish counterpart on the course of the negotiations between the Russian and Ukrainian representatives.
Erdogan, for his part, expressed the hope for a positive outcome of the talks between Russia and Ukraine. According to him, if a permanent ceasefire is declared, then the way to a long-term settlement will be opened, according to the office of the Turkish leader.
In addition, Erdogan reaffirmed his readiness to receive the presidents of Russia and Ukraine in Ankara or Istanbul.
